From the mind of Albert Adrià, brother of Ferran Adrià of the famed el Bulli, Tickets is not your typical Barcelona Tapas bar; it is a truly theatrical dining experience. The playful menu is rooted in molecular gastronomy and the over-the-top décor matches the whimsical plates. Reservations are extremely hard to get, and the waiting list is months long; plan ahead and be tenacious! A seat at the bar is the best experience – providing a front row view of the chefs at work. You can order from the menu but the better route, if you’re feeling adventurous and aren’t worried about the price tag, is the tasting experience. There is no talk of prices and the myriad of tiny artful tapas keep coming until you literally call STOP.
TIP: Reservations are released at midnight, but it has to be both midnight in Barcelona and on your computer, so set your clock appropriately and keep trying!
